plain 12 Posted December 11, 2008 Hey Peaches. It sounds like a "head issue" you're dealing with...not a "band issue". Personally, I think it's easiest to break that sugar craving by going cold turkey. After I don't eat sugar for awhile, it doesn't even sound good to me. Probably not what you want to hear, but your band is not real good at controlling stuff like this. This is where the "it's just a tool" part comes in. You have to make the hard choices about what you eat. Maybe it would be best to not even bring goodies (er....actually I guess they would be "baddies", LOL) like that into the house where you'll be tempted?
